Attachment requirements for hosts running the Windows NT operating system

This section provides an overview of the requirements for attaching the SAN Volume Controller to a host running the Windows NT® operating system.

The following list provides the requirements for attaching the SAN Volume Controller to your host running the Windows NT operating system:
  • Check the LUN limitations for your host system. Ensure that there are enough fibre-channel adapters installed in the server to handle the total LUNs that you want to attach.
  • Ensure that you have the documentation for your Windows NT operating system and the IBM System Storage SAN Volume Controller Model 2145-XXX Hardware Installation Guide. All SAN Volume Controller publications are available from the following Web site:

    www.ibm.com/storage/support/2145

  • Ensure that you have installed the supported hardware and software on your host, including the following:
    • Operating system service packs and patches
    • Host Bus Adapters (HBAs)
    • HBA device drivers
    • Multipathing drivers
    • Clustering software

    The following IBM® Web site provides current interoperability information about HBA and platform levels:

    www.ibm.com/storage/support/2145
